A new report shows a much lower U.S. trade deficit as tariffs restricted both imports and exports, but some experts say the effects may be temporary.
The overall trade gap plunged 39% to $29.4 billion in October, as imports fell by 3.2%, Department of Commerce figures show. The deficit was significantly lower than the $58.4 billion median forecast from surveys of economists by Dow Jones Newswires and The Wall Street Journal.
